I'm sure you might be witnessing some traffic spike, but was this launch able to bring in any serious leads? 3-4 founders I talked to regarding their launch, and they were like PH doesn't get actual leads in B2B, for B2C since usage and time to value is very short, there might be some users.

    1. 1

      It has – I've had a ton of web traffic, a big newsletter mention, and ~60 new users start a subscription trial since the launch. Way more valuable than the website traffic and app users has been the feedback though. I'm excited to continue iterating with the new clarity it brought.
